基于非线性动力的有限元强度折减法边坡稳定性分析

摘    要:以金安桥水电站枢纽区堆积体边坡为研究对象,基于非线性动力响应分析理论及有限元强度折减法理论,考虑地震工况下边坡的动力响应,采用有限元强度折减法,计算天然边坡蓄水前后的边坡稳定安全系数,获得边坡临界滑动时的塑性区分析,确定边坡失稳类型并对边坡的稳定性进行评价,提出合理的边坡处治措施。

Analysis on Slope Stability by Strength Reduction FEM Based on Nonlinear Dynamic

Abstract:Taking the deposits slope in the nodal region of Jin'anqiao Hydropower Station as the study object, on the basis of nonlinear dynamic response analysis and strength reduction FEM, the dynamic response of slope in case of earthquake is considered; by strength reduction FEM, the stability safety coefficients of natural slope before and after ponding are calculated so as to obtain the plastic-zone analysis in critical slip of the slope, confirm the failure type, assess the slope stability, and propose the rational treating measures.
